Check the illuminated entry function.
(1)
When all the doors are locked, pressing the UNLOCK switch causes the interior light (when the
light switch is in the DOOR position) to illuminate simultaneously with the unlock operation.
(2)
Check that the interior light fade out in approximately 30 seconds if doors have not been opened.
(j)
Check the remote panic alarm function.
Check that the horn sounds and the headlights and taillights flash for 60 seconds by the TVIP alarm
function when the PANIC switch is pressed. Also, check that the horn stops sounding and the lights
stop flashing when either switch of the transmitter is pressed or any door is either locked or unlocked
using the key.

Check the ignition-controlled automatic door lock/unlock function.
HINT:
This function's initial mode is OFF, however the program for this function can be changed using the specified
method (see page
BE-170
(1)
Insert the key into the ignition key cylinder and turn the ignition switch to on the ON or START
position. Check that all the doors are automatically locked.
(2)
Turn the key back to the ACC or LOCK position, and check that all the doors automatically un-
locked.
